/ACCGO/UIS_API036 Event ID is missing in event data
typically occurs in the context of the SAP Universal Integration Services (UIS) or when dealing with event handling in SAP applications. This error indicates that the system expected an Event ID in the data being processed, but it was not found.Cause:
Missing Event ID: The primary cause of this error is that the event data being processed does not contain a required Event ID. This could be due to:
- Incorrect configuration of the event data source.
- Data being sent to the system is incomplete or improperly formatted.
- A bug in the application or integration logic that fails to populate the Event ID.
Data Mapping Issues: If there are issues in the mapping of data fields between systems, the Event ID may not be correctly passed or recognized.
Integration Issues: If the event data is coming from an external system, there may be issues with the integration layer that prevents the Event ID from being included.
Solution:
Check Event Data Source: Verify the source of the event data to ensure that it is correctly configured to include the Event ID. This may involve checking the data extraction or generation process.
Validate Data Format: Ensure that the data being sent to the SAP system is in the correct format and includes all required fields, including the Event ID.
Debugging: If you have access to the development environment, you can debug the process to see where the Event ID is being lost. This may involve checking the code that generates or processes the event data.
Review Integration Logic: If the event data is coming from an external system, review the integration logic to ensure that the Event ID is being correctly passed through.
Consult Documentation: Check the SAP documentation for any specific requirements regarding event data and Event IDs. There may be additional configuration steps or prerequisites that need to be addressed.
Error Logs: Review the error logs for more detailed information about the error. This may provide additional context that can help in diagnosing the issue.
SAP Support: If the issue persists and you are unable to resolve it, consider reaching out to SAP support for assistance. They may have additional insights or patches available for known issues.
